Transaction 571787514f27f67558704047e84b2f2b79661f459a37a64de4922f6eb1f3cb02
1 Input
1 Output
-
571787514f27f67558704047e84b2f2b79661f459a37a64de4922f6eb1f3cb02:0
- value
- 393438
- script pubkey
- OP_0 OP_PUSHBYTES_32 fcb95c132eb97b29e08a47885d68ed2f8b2efc5c76112cb70d28c74e48f4fa87
- address
- bc1qlju4cyewh9ajncy2g7y9668d979jalzuwcgjedcd9rr5uj85l2rs2v3mta